Bug description:
  My kernel cmdline has the following fb setting:
  omapfb.mode=dvi:1280x720MR-32@60. Reverting to MR-16@60 fixes this
  (but looks worse in X due to 16bit color)

  This setting works in X (all is fine) but in the console colors are
  wrong, see the attached photo for details.
